Transaction 255738a6804ce968d6564be366b48a675615b834f9781c7a12d1b58394bd5356
1 Input
2 Outputs
- 255738a6804ce968d6564be366b48a675615b834f9781c7a12d1b58394bd5356:0
- 255738a6804ce968d6564be366b48a675615b834f9781c7a12d1b58394bd5356:1
value 50000000
address 14U95u9EmbXwhAXg26TdgbJYMc6mPQKov7
value 96688700
address 1PJb4TT8rYo3brUGhXgJpMUcDtwDbdN8jf